Specifications
Data Rate: 10Mbps
Supplier Device Package: 5-MFP
Package / Case: 6-SOIC (0.173", 4.40mm Width), 5 Leads
Mounting Type: Surface Mount
Operating Temperature: -40°C ~ 85°C
Voltage - Supply: 4.5 V ~ 5.5 V
Current - DC Forward (If) (Max): 20mA
Voltage - Forward (Vf) (Typ): 1.6V
Rise / Fall Time (Typ): 20ns, 10ns
Propagation Delay tpLH / tpHL (Max): 75ns, 75ns
Series: OPIC™
Current - Output / Channel: 50mA
Output Type: Open Collector
Input Type: DC
Common Mode Transient Immunity (Min): 10kV/µs
Voltage - Isolation: 3750Vrms
Inputs - Side 1/Side 2: 1/0
Number of Channels: 1
Part Status: Obsolete
Packaging: Tape & Reel (TR)

Optoisolators are a type of isolator used to transfer signals between two circuits while providing electrical isolation between the two. The PC410L0NIT0F optoisolator is a type of Logic Output optoisolator and is one of the most commonly used optoisolators in fields such as power, control, and automation. The PC410L0NIT0F optoisolator is used to transfer logic signals between two circuits while providing complete electrical isolation between the two. The PC410L0NIT0F optoisolator uses a simple design and has a wide range of applications.

The PC410L0NIT0F optoisolator contains two main components: the LED and the phototransistor. The LED emits light when triggered and the phototransistor detects the light and converts it into an electrical signal. This signal is then sent to the other side of the device where it is used to activate a circuit or control a device. The PC410L0NIT0F also contains an isolator which provides electrical isolation between the two circuits, thus eliminating any chance of ground loops or interference.
